mafrota wrote:

>What distribution ( Red Hat 6.x or Red Hat 7.x or whatever) and packages
>(linuxconf-1.27-1.i386.rpm or whatever) are necessary to perform a proper
>isntallation of linuxconf in YDL 2.1?
>
1) Find a distro which still has a linuxconf (RH was dropping it last I
knew, because it's leaky as a seive security wise.) Download linuxconf
from the srpms.
2) Try to compile up the rpm using rpm --rebuild <package>.src.rpm .
Take note of any failed dependencies.
3) If you have failed dependencies, download those srpms and return to
2) with the failed dependencies... after they have built, install them
and return to what you tried to install previously.

4) When you have installed all of linuxconf's prerequisites, install
linuxconf: rpm --install /usr/src/rpm/BUILD/ppc/linuxconf-blah-.ppc.rpm
(you will have to install linuxconf dependencies in the same way).

If this sounds complicated, it is...
